Spain has a low proportion of youths enrolled in vocational training programs (12% of 15-19 year olds, compared to an OECD average of 25%) despite the fact that demand is clear: 40.3% of job offers in 2018 were aimed at profiles with Vocational Training qualifications. Likewise, by 2030, projections by the European Centre for the Development of Vocational Training show that new jobs created in Spain will require 65% of professionals to have semi-skilled qualifications (Cedefop, EU, 2018).

So begins the report ‘The challenges for the future of Vocational Training in Spain’, prepared by COTEC, Fundación Dualiza Caixabank and Fundación Telefónica, which we are presenting today.
